I discovered the following problem in the geno() elements of the VCF object 
when I load multiple regions from a .vcf file:

## Correct
tmp = readVcf(system.file("extdata", "chr22.vcf.gz", package="VariantAnnotation"), 
"hg19")[1:10]
geno(tmp)$GT
            HG00096 HG00097 HG00099 HG00100 HG00101
rs7410291   "0|0"   "0|0"   "1|0"   "0|0"   "0|0"
rs147922003 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s114143073 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s141778433 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s182170314 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s115145310 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s186769856 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s77627744  "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s193230365 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s9627788   "0|0"   "0|0"   "1|0"   "0|0"   "0|0"

## Wrong: Load regions separately using ScanVcfParam(which= )
tmp2 = readVcf(system.file("extdata", "chr22.vcf.gz", package="VariantAnnotation"), 
"hg19", param=ScanVcfParam(which=rowData(tmp)))
geno(tmp2)$GT
            HG00096 HG00097 HG00099 HG00100 HG00101
rs7410291   "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s147922003 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s114143073 "1|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s141778433 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s182170314 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s115145310 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s186769856 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s77627744  "0|0"   "0|0"   "0|0"   "0|0"   "1|0"
rs193230365 "0|0"   "0|0"   "0|0"   "0|0"   "0|0"
rs9627788   "0|0"   "0|0"   "0|0"   "0|0"   "0|0"

Note how the elements have been added by column instead of by row.

The following solved the issue for me:

$svn diff VariantAnnotation/
Index: VariantAnnotation/R/AllUtilities.R
===================================================================
--- VariantAnnotation/R/AllUtilities.R  (revision 73920)
+++ VariantAnnotation/R/AllUtilities.R  (working copy)
@@ -62,8 +62,8 @@
                     cmb
                 } else {
                     trans <- lapply(elt, t)
-                    cmb <- matrix(t(do.call(c, trans)),
-                                  length(lst[["rowData"]]), d[2])
+                    cmb <- matrix(do.call(c, trans),
+                                  length(lst[["rowData"]]), d[2], byrow=TRUE)
                     cmb
                 }
             })


My suspicion is that the transposition t() on line 65 didn't do the desired 
job, as do.call() returned a vector..

I don't fully understand the code, so it may be worth double checking.
For example, I didn't check the case when the individual geno entries contain 
more than a single value for each variant and sample.

The same problem also occurred for VariantAnnotation_1.4.9.
